[iOS] Black lines on illuminated mesh surface on A11 and later SoCs
Reproduction steps:
1. Open the attached project ("Project link" in the edit).
2. Build and run it on an A11 or later iOS device.
Actual behavior (Red car model with actual vs expected behavior screenshots attached):
- The object is covered with black lines.
Reproduced with:
iPhone X iOS 12.0 A11;
iPhone X, iOS 13.0, A11;
iPad Pro 3rd gen, iOS 13.1.2, A12;
iPhone 11, iOS 13.0, A13;
2017.1.5f1, 2017.2.3p2, 2017.4.7f1, 2018.1.9f1, 2018.2.0f2, 2018.3.0a5, 2020.1.0a13
Metal, GLES
Not reproducible with:
iPad Mini, iOS 9.3.5, A5;
iPhone 5c, iOS 9.3.2, A6;
iPad Mini 2, iOS 9.2.1, A7;
iPod touch 6 Gen, iOS 10.2.1, A8;
iPad 5 Gen, iOS 10.3.3, A9
iPhone 6S iOS 11.0 A9;
iPhone 7 iOS 11.1.1 A10

Resolution Note:
This is a GPU driver issue and has been reported. a workaround is to disable cutout or MSAA.
